Transaction 2137175f0345fd0d50e2518881e2d3ca7945a1d3b4a249d798ac692e098618a4

3 Input
2 Outputs
  • 2137175f0345fd0d50e2518881e2d3ca7945a1d3b4a249d798ac692e098618a4:0
  • value  23512900
    address  1DvXWJHHSaiZJDuuUSAFt67r9xio3vWzsF
  • 2137175f0345fd0d50e2518881e2d3ca7945a1d3b4a249d798ac692e098618a4:1
  • value  7529061
    address  1F3fKYy5DLVAzzoHeGZcPhW4cwtnpMHaKz